the sum of the ages of farhan and his cousin is 38. Seven years ago, Farhan was thrice as old as his cousin. Find farhan’s present age.​

Answers

Answer:-

Let the present age of Farhan be x years

and , the present age of his cousin be y years.

Now, according to the Question

It is given that the sum of age of Farhan & his cousin is 38 year

⟹ x + y = 38

⟹ x = 38-y ---------(i)

again, according to the 2nd condition

Seven years ago, Farhan was thrice as old as his cousin

⟹ (x -7) =3 (y-7)

⟹ x -7 = 3y -21

⟹ 38-y -7 = 3y -21 (From equation 1st)

⟹ 31+21 = 3y +y

⟹ 52 = 4y

⟹ 4y = 52

⟹ y = 52/4

⟹ y = 13

Now putting the value of y = 13 in equation (i) we get

⟹ x = 38-13

⟹ x = 25

Hence, 

the present age of Farhan is 25 years.

And , the Present age of his cousin is 13 years.

The two main groupings of nations during World War II were the Allied Powers and the Axis Powers

True / False

Answers

Answer: True

Explanation:

In the Second World War, the two main groups opposing each other were the Allies and the Axis powers.

The Allies comprised of various nations as the war progressed. The main ones however were the United Kingdom and her empire and the United States. France can be considered part of the group because of their government in exile but the puppet Vichy government was on the German side.

The Axis powers included the dictatorial nations of Germany, Italy and Japan, These nations conquered massive territories at the start of the war but the Allies kept recapturing these lands until the war ended in Allied victory.

What are the roles of diplomatic mission?​

Answers

Answer:The functions of a diplomatic mission consist in representing the sending State in the receiving State; protecting in the receiving State the interests of the sending State and of its nationals, within the limits permitted by international law; negotiating with the Government of the receiving State;
